Medical Summary also referred to as Medical Chronology and Medical Synopsis is a document consisting of the events that have taken place in a patient’s treatment. Summarizing of medical records is a very important part of a personal injury, mass tort, nursing home abuse, long-term care, medical malpractice and allied cases.

Summaries are of two types:

Comprehensive medical summary

In a comprehensive medical summary, the physician reviews the entire set of medical records and captures events that are relevant to the case, including important points pertaining to the case. It is captured chronologically with hot-linked bate numbers for easy reference to the relevant records. In this summary no relevant data is missed out, so the reviewer gets a comprehensive summary that is required for the case.

Narrative summary

Narrative summary is usually done before accepting a case. It gives a fair understanding of whether the case is worth fighting for on not. This summary is a gist of the entire medical records, summarized in a page or two, so the reviewer does not have to spend too much of time in analyzing the value of a case.

This summary may not be captured chronologically nor would be good enough to understand the timeline of events. It may, however, have reference to the records, so you know where it is coming from.
